This audiobook is narrated by a digital voice. Scottie Price is twenty-nine, newly single, and ready for a fresh start in New York City. She’s determined to make this summer about herself, not about finding someone else. From coffee spills on her first day to awkward office meetings surrounded by married coworkers, Scottie’s story is honest, funny, and full of the little moments that make city life feel real. She’s not looking for a rom-com love story but looking to feel good in her own skin again. With a job at Butter Putter, a neighbor who never holds back her opinions, and a bodega guy who still doesn’t know her name, Scottie’s days are equal parts messy and hopeful. Along the way, she learns that you don’t need a perfect plan or a perfect partner to enjoy your life. Sometimes, it’s the small wins, like finally getting a “Hey, Scottie!” at the corner store, that matter most. If you like stories about starting over, laughing at life’s chaos, and rooting for someone who’s just trying to figure it out, Till Summer Do Us Part is for you.
